U.S. Exports Rise 17.9 Percent in First Seven Months of 2010

WASHINGTON, D.C. – / N2N / – Exports of U.S. goods and services increased 17.9 percent during the first seven months of 2010, according to data released by the Bureau of Economic Analysis of the U.S. Commerce Department. Obama Signs Executive Order for National Ocean Policy

WASHINGTON – / N2N / – The Obama administration has charted a new course for our ocean. President Obama signed an Executive Order, which establishes a national ocean policy and creates a framework for protecting our ocean, coasts and Great Lakes through coastal and marine spatial planning. U.S. Exports Up 16.9% in First 4 Months of 2010

WASHINGTON, D.C. – / N2N / – U.S. exports of goods and services increased by 16.9 percent during the first four months of 2010, according to data released by the Census Bureau and the Bureau of Economic Analysis of the U.S. Commerce Department. Obama Urged to Waive Jones Act to Help Gulf Oil Cleanup

WASHINGTON – / N2N / – The nation’s premier taxpayer watchdog group, Citizens Against Government Waste (CAGW), today urged President Obama to take a significant step toward resolving the oil spill in the Gulf of Mexico by waiving the Jones Act, which prohibits foreign ships from carrying cargo and passengers between U.S. ports. 22 U.S. Companies Get Award for Outstanding Exports

WASHINGTON – / N2N / – U.S. Commerce Secretary Gary Locke today presented 22 companies and organizations with the 2010 Presidential “E” Award and “E” Star Award for outstanding contributions to growing U.S. exports, strengthening the economy and creating American jobs.
